Largest lead lost for NYK since 1991-1992 season.
 
I despise Hornacek. We blow a 27-point lead and lose.
Burke, Kornet, Hicks, and Dotson all play zero minutes.
Ntilikina plays only 10 minutes, hitting both his shots and getting 2 steals, although he managed to be -8, the worst on the team, in those 10 minutes.
Mudiay plays 20 minutes and has more turnovers (4) than assists (3) plus shoots only 3 for 9 from the floor including 0 for 2 from 3-point range.
Someone check Michael Beasley's ID and make sure he isn't Melo in disguise. Beasley plays 40 minutes and shoots 8 for 24.
 
Last edited:
On the bright side, Kanter was a beast again tonight, putting up 24 points on 9 for 15 shooting, 14 boards, and 5 assists. Still not sure Kanter's market value at this point. Is his 18.6 million player option high enough for him to opt in or does he test the market for a long-term deal?

I'd love to say THJ was a bright spot too, but he shot 12 for 14 in the 1st half and 2 for 10 in the 2nd half. We all saw how far that got us.
 
Loss #36 for the season with 23 games to play after the All-Star break. Right this second we are now tied for the 8th most losses in the NBA, however we'll go back to 9th most losses in the NBA after Chicago finishes losing tonight. We are in the mix though for a top pick. The most losses any team has is 41 (Atlanta).
